Electric Vehicles, Tracking, Charging StationAbstract
This study aims to provide information about battery recharge locations through the Recharge App. The research method employed is Research and Development (RnD) using the 4-D model (Define, Design, Develop, and Disseminate). Research tools and instruments include surveys, interviews, as well as frontend and backend development devices. The research findings indicate a user satisfaction rate of 90%. However, some features such as notifications and sharing functions require further development. Limited launch through social media platforms and user feedback are utilized to guide further development. This study demonstrates the significant potential of the application in providing beneficial information services, yet further refinement is necessary to achieve optimal functionality in meeting users' needs comprehensively.
